E.s.r. studies of ion association. Part 6.—A study of atom transfer between potassium-2,5-di-t-butyl p-benzosemiquinone and 2,5-di-t-butyl p-benzoquinone

Abstract

It is argued that the electron spin resonance spectrum of an ion-pair simultaneously undergoing intramolecular cation exchange between equivalent conformations and intermolecular atom transfer with neutral parent molecules may fortuitously show a binomial intensity distribution even though both exchange processes may be going at rates of the order required to produce linewidth effects. Experiments with potassium-2,5-di-t-butyl p-benzosemiquinone illustrate the phenomenon. At room temperature the rate constant for the reaction TBPBSQ-potassium + TBPBQ ⇌ TBPBQ + potassium-TBPBSQ is estimated to be 6.43 × 107 M–1 s–1.
